Here in Athol, Massachusetts, nestled within the scenic Pioneer Valley, our thriving nursing job market is as vibrant as our community life. Though our small-town charm may not draw the same attention as bigger cities, the nursing opportunities here are robust, appealing especially to local professionals and travel nurses. According to recent statistics and my observations, the average nursing salary ranges between $34 to $39 hourly, translating to an annual salary of approximately $71,000 to $81,000. In comparison, the national average for registered nurses is about $37 per hour and around $77,600 annually, while Massachusetts stands a bit higher at approximately $40 per hour or $83,300 per year. The nursing job market here is not just stable; it’s set to grow. Currently, there are around 400 nurses employed in Athol, and the demand is projected to increase due to an aging population and the upcoming retirement of existing healthcare professionals. NurseRecruiter estimates that the city will require an additional 60 new nurses in the next 3-5 years—a trajectory fueled by new healthcare facilities and expanding services at our local hospitals. Notably, Athol Memorial Hospital is one of our primary employers, along with various outpatient clinics that have recently emerged. For those looking to explore travel nursing, while we may not be a top seasonal hotspot like some coastal regions, there are still ample opportunities, particularly during the summer months when local health initiatives and community events ramp up. As for per diem nursing, our market consists of approximately 30% of nursing positions being available in this flexible work format, fostering a diverse set of opportunities to suit different lifestyles.

Do I need to be licensed in Massachusetts to work in Athol?
Yes, Massachusetts has not adopted the eNLC compact agreement, so you will need to hold a Massachusetts nursing license.
